Hot Honey Pepperoni & Ricotta Pan Pizza

A thick, airy pan pizza topped with crispy cup-and-char pepperoni, creamy ricotta dollops, and a generous drizzle of spicy hot honey. A perfect blend of sweet, savory, and spicy.

Ingredients
  

Pizza Base
  • 1 lb pizza dough homemade or store-bought
  • 2 tbsp olive oil for the pan
  • 0.5 cup pizza sauce
  • 2 cups mozzarella cheese shredded
Toppings
  • 6 oz pepperoni natural casing/cup-and-char style
  • 1 cup whole milk ricotta drained
  • 0.25 cup parmesan cheese grated
  • 2 tbsp hot honey for drizzling
  • 1 tbsp fresh rosemary chopped

Equipment

  • 12-inch Cast Iron Skillet or Baking Sheet
  • Stand Mixer or Mixing Bowl
  • Pizza Cutter
  • Pastry brush

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ven to 500°F (260°C). Pour olive oil into a 12-inch cast-iron skillet or baking sheet, coating the bottom and sides.
  2. Place dough in the pan and stretch towards the edges. Let rest for 30 minutes to puff up.
  3. Dimple the dough with your fingertips. Spread sauce evenly, leaving a crust border.
  4. Top with mozzarella and parmesan cheeses.
  5. Arrange pepperoni slices over the cheese and drop dollops of ricotta in the gaps.
  6. Bake for 12-15 minutes until crust is deep golden brown and pepperoni is crispy.
  7. Remove from oven and immediately drizzle with hot honey. Garnish with fresh rosemary.
  8. Let cool for 5 minutes before slicing.

Notes

For a crispier bottom crust, finish the pizza on the stovetop over medium heat for 2-3 minutes after baking. If you can't find hot honey, mix 2 tablespoons of regular honey with 1/2 teaspoon of cayenne pepper or hot sauce.
